Chalfont St Giles is a picturesque village with a good range of the amenities required for day-to-day living.
SCHOOLS:
There are nursery, infant and primary schools in the village.
Dr Challoner's Grammar School for Boys is in Amersham and Dr Challoner's High School for Girls is in Little Chalfont. Chalfont Community College is in nearby Chalfont St Peter.
For the commuter, there are Mainline Stations in Gerrards Cross and Chalfont & Latimer. Fast and frequent services are available to London Marylebone and Baker Street on the Chiltern and Metropolitan lines.
